Transaction e3b70dafc456a23a266f7e25dad9f4079687e18501ab11ce94f346e783bf58af

2 Input
2 Outputs
  • e3b70dafc456a23a266f7e25dad9f4079687e18501ab11ce94f346e783bf58af:0
  • value  1353626
    address  3Jo5Rwjp6c5WPJXpYgudecVaqS3zkJsWUS
  • e3b70dafc456a23a266f7e25dad9f4079687e18501ab11ce94f346e783bf58af:1
  • value  56475572
    address  3CDENCr2EEDpeepGRg7K4oja3PtYF87VDz